Drake is a proud dad.

In honor of Father's Day, Champagne Papi shared a special gift that he received from his son Adonis. Taking to Instagram, Drizzy posted a photo of the artwork that says "Dad" in a stencil cut with paint stains around.

"Happy Father's Day," he subtitled.

Adonis, who will be two years old in October, turns out to be quite the artist. Drake had previously shared the works of art he had received from his son for Christmas. "Adonis> Picasso, do not call me," he wrote at the time.

The artistic gene runs in the family. Sophie Brussaux, Adonis' mother, is a talented painter and regularly shares her art on Instagram.

Drake is open about becoming a father and meeting his son for the first time in his life. Scorpio album. "I only met once, I introduced St Nick," he rapped on "March 14th." "I think that he had to bring 20 gifts."

When he appeared on HBO's "The Shop," he also talked about Adonis. "I have a son, he's a handsome boy," he told LeBron James. "Crazy blue eyes, blue eyes."

Drake is still celebrating the NBA Raptors championship. In honor of the Toronto team 's first ever win, he dropped his "Best in the World Pack" featuring two new tracks – "Omertà" and "Money in the Grave" with Rick Ross.
